Output 309b41dc0bb4bcab7dbde84253c42d723d395bc97c577e1ba2d42e9035f2df25:1

value
270684781
script pubkey
OP_0 OP_PUSHBYTES_20 d26f688a76bbf5e55e644068a58132d476b18faf
address
bc1q6fhk3znkh0672hnygp52tqfj63mtrra0fyc5z8
transaction
309b41dc0bb4bcab7dbde84253c42d723d395bc97c577e1ba2d42e9035f2df25
confirmations
283728
spent
true